Don’t Get Hooked: Why Email Security Needs More Than a Spam Filter

1. Introduction: Modern Threats Behind Familiar Emails

Email has evolved into a primary target for cybercriminals, far beyond the days of generic spam. Sophisticated phishing schemes, impersonation attacks, and business email compromise (BEC) now dominate the threat landscape. Small and mid-sized businesses (SMBs), particularly those without advanced safeguards, are especially vulnerable.

Relying on a basic spam filter to guard against these evolving threats is inadequate. The modern email threat landscape demands proactive measures and integrated security protocols that go far beyond keyword-based filtering.

2. Understanding Email-Based Attacks

Email-based attacks come in many forms, but they all share a common goal: to deceive the recipient and exploit trust. Phishing emails often masquerade as legitimate communication, prompting users to click on malicious links or share credentials. Spear phishing adds another layer of danger by customizing messages to individual targets, making them far more convincing.

BEC attacks have caused billions in global losses. By spoofing a company executive’s email or hijacking an account, attackers can trick employees into authorizing wire transfers or revealing sensitive data. These targeted attacks often bypass traditional filters, which is why implementing advanced security strategies is so important.

3. Why Spam Filters Fall Short

Traditional spam filters operate on pattern recognition, flagging suspicious domains or keywords. While this is helpful for stopping general spam, it does little to prevent sophisticated attacks that mimic internal communications or legitimate vendors.

Today’s phishing tactics often use clean language and familiar branding. Attackers frequently study your organization, making their emails appear authentic. Without behavioral analytics and contextual monitoring, these messages can pass through filters undetected.

4. The Role of AI in Email Threat Detection

Artificial intelligence is reshaping cybersecurity by enabling smarter, faster threat detection. AI-driven platforms can analyze vast datasets in real time, learning to distinguish between genuine communications and subtle phishing attempts.

5. Why SMBs Are Prime Targets

SMBs are often targeted because they typically lack the extensive cybersecurity infrastructure found in larger enterprises. Attackers assume these businesses will rely on minimal protection, such as standalone spam filters, without layered defenses.

With fewer IT resources, SMBs may also delay patching vulnerabilities or updating software, increasing exposure. A single compromised inbox can lead to ransomware deployment, credential theft, or widespread data loss.

7. Email’s Role in Compliance

Email communication frequently involves personal data, financial information, or healthcare records. If mishandled, this can lead to compliance violations under regulations like HIPAA, PCI-DSS, or GDPR.

To remain compliant, SMBs must ensure email platforms meet encryption standards, archive messages securely, and restrict access based on roles. Without a managed solution, enforcing these rules consistently can become complex.

9. When a Spam Filter Fails: Real-World Consequences

The failure of a spam filter can have devastating consequences:

  • Credential theft from phishing attacks
  • Data exfiltration from malware
  • Financial fraud through BEC scams
  • Downtime due to ransomware

These outcomes emphasize the need for a complete email protection strategy that goes beyond basic filtering.
